How To Safely Remove Wax From Fruits: A Simple Guide

can you remove wax from fruit

Removing wax from fruit is a common concern for those who prioritize consuming clean, chemical-free produce. Many fruits, such as apples, pears, and citrus, are often coated with a thin layer of wax to enhance their appearance, extend shelf life, and protect against moisture loss. While food-grade waxes are generally considered safe for consumption, some individuals prefer to remove it for health, dietary, or personal reasons. Methods for removing wax include washing the fruit with warm water and mild soap, using vinegar or baking soda solutions, or peeling the skin. Understanding the type of wax used and the best removal techniques can help ensure that fruits are as natural and clean as desired.

Hot Water Method: Dip fruit in hot water to soften wax for easy removal

A simple yet effective technique to remove wax from fruit is the hot water method, which involves dipping the fruit in hot water to soften the wax for easy removal. This method is particularly useful for those who prefer to consume their fruits without the wax coating, which can be a concern for individuals with dietary restrictions or those who simply prefer a more natural option.

The Science Behind the Method

When fruit is dipped in hot water, the heat causes the wax to soften and lose its adhesion to the fruit's surface. The ideal water temperature for this method is around 120-140°F (49-60°C), which is hot enough to soften the wax but not so hot as to damage the fruit. It's essential to note that the water should not be boiling, as this can cause the fruit to become mushy or discolored. A good rule of thumb is to heat the water until it's too hot to touch comfortably, but not scalding.

Step-by-Step Guide

To use the hot water method, start by filling a large bowl or sink with hot water at the recommended temperature. Gently place the fruit into the water, ensuring it's fully submerged. Allow the fruit to soak for 30-60 seconds, depending on the thickness of the wax coating. Thicker coatings may require a slightly longer soaking time. After soaking, remove the fruit from the water and use a soft-bristled brush or cloth to gently scrub away the softened wax. Be careful not to damage the fruit's surface, especially if it's delicate, like berries or peaches.

Vinegar Solution: Use vinegar and water to dissolve wax on fruit surfaces

A simple yet effective method to remove wax from fruit surfaces involves a vinegar solution, a household staple known for its mild acidity and cleaning properties. This approach is particularly appealing for those seeking a natural, chemical-free way to clean their produce. The science behind it is straightforward: the acetic acid in vinegar can help break down the wax, making it easier to rinse away.

The Process Unveiled: To create this solution, mix one part vinegar with three parts water. White vinegar is typically recommended due to its higher acidity compared to other types. For instance, a practical mixture could be 1 cup of vinegar and 3 cups of water, which is sufficient for soaking several pieces of fruit. Submerge the fruit in this solution for about 10-15 minutes. The wax will begin to dissolve, and you may notice a cloudy appearance in the water as the wax particles separate. After soaking, gently scrub the fruit with a soft brush or cloth to remove any remaining wax, and then rinse thoroughly with clean water.

This method is especially useful for fruits with thicker wax coatings, such as apples, pears, and citrus fruits. It's a gentle process that doesn't require harsh chemicals, making it suitable for organic produce and those with sensitive skin who may handle the fruit. The vinegar solution is a cost-effective and accessible alternative to commercial produce washes, which often contain ingredients some consumers prefer to avoid.

Baking Soda Scrub: Gently scrub fruit with baking soda to remove wax residue

Fruit wax, often used to enhance appearance and prolong shelf life, can be a concern for those seeking a truly natural experience. While it’s generally considered safe, some prefer to remove it for texture, taste, or personal preference. Enter the baking soda scrub—a simple, effective, and chemical-free method to tackle wax residue. This approach leverages baking soda’s mild abrasiveness and natural cleaning properties to gently lift wax without damaging the fruit’s skin.

Steps to Execute the Baking Soda Scrub:

  • Prepare the Solution: Mix 1 tablespoon of baking soda with enough water to form a thick paste. The consistency should be gritty yet spreadable, ensuring it adheres to the fruit’s surface.
  • Apply and Scrub: Using your fingers or a soft brush, gently massage the paste onto the fruit. Focus on areas where wax tends to accumulate, such as the apple’s skin or a cucumber’s waxy coating.
  • Rinse Thoroughly: After scrubbing, rinse the fruit under cold water to remove the baking soda and loosened wax. Pat dry with a clean cloth or paper towel.

Cautions and Considerations:

While baking soda is gentle, over-scrubbing can damage delicate fruits like berries or peaches. For such fruits, reduce pressure and use a softer tool, like a sponge. Additionally, avoid leaving baking soda residue, as it can alter the fruit’s flavor. Always test the method on a small area first, especially with exotic or thin-skinned fruits.

Why Baking Soda Works:

Baking soda’s alkaline nature helps break down the wax’s oily composition, while its fine texture provides just enough abrasion to lift it away. Unlike harsh chemicals, it’s food-safe and environmentally friendly, making it ideal for household use. This method is particularly effective for fruits with thicker wax coatings, such as apples, pears, or citrus.

Peeling Technique: Peel fruit skin to eliminate wax coating entirely

Peeling the skin of fruit is a straightforward method to entirely remove the wax coating often applied for preservation and aesthetic purposes. This technique is particularly effective for fruits with thin, edible skins, such as apples, pears, and certain citrus varieties. By carefully removing the outer layer, you eliminate not only the wax but also potential pesticides or residues, ensuring a cleaner and potentially healthier consumption experience. However, this method does come with the trade-off of losing some nutrients concentrated in the skin, such as fiber and antioxidants.

To execute the peeling technique, start by selecting a sharp peeler or paring knife suited to the fruit’s texture. For apples and pears, a standard vegetable peeler works efficiently, while citrus fruits may require a serrated knife for precision. Begin at the stem end, applying gentle pressure to avoid removing too much flesh. Work your way around the fruit in a spiral or vertical motion, depending on its shape. For smaller fruits like plums or peaches, blanching in hot water for 30 seconds can loosen the skin, making it easier to peel. Always peel over a bowl or trash bin to minimize mess.

While peeling is effective, it’s essential to weigh its practicality for daily use. This method is time-consuming and may not be ideal for large quantities of fruit. Additionally, not all fruits are suitable for peeling; bananas and berries, for instance, cannot be peeled without rendering them inedible.
